The district of Braga is a district in the northwest of Portugal. The district capital is the city of Braga, and it is bordered by the district of Viana do Castelo in the north, Vila Real in the east, Galicia in the northeast and Porto in the... Wikipedia
Area: 1,032 mi²
Capital: Braga
Historical province: Minho
ISO 3166 code: PT-03
No. of municipalities: 14
Region: Norte
